Latvian

Stirnāzis

Alternative forms

Etymology

From stirnu (roe deer[gen.]) +‎ āzis (buck).

Pronunciation

This entry needs an audio pronunciation. If you are a native speaker with a microphone, please record this word. The recorded pronunciation will appear here when it's ready.

Noun

stirnāzis m (2nd declension)

  1. male roe deer (Capreolus capreolus)
    stirnāzis dzenā kazu ap krūmu trakā ātrumā līdz galīgam pagurumamthe male roe deer drives the female around the bush at a crazy speed until she is tired (lit. to final tiredness)
